GRE scores, Part II: Assume that scores on the verbal portion of the GRE (Graduate Record Exam) follow the normal distribution with a mean score 151 and standard deviation of 7 points, while the quantitative portion of the exam has scores following the normal distribution with mean 153 and standard deviation 7.67. Use this information to answer the following:
(a) Find the score of a student who scored in the 80th percentile on the Quantitative Reasoning section of the exam. ..............(Please round to two decimal places)
